Output e5ca9046bfec602d9b866b7784a8f1fbaf5e600a5429932bc7bb45e94c494da7:3

value
34634326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2452a1cc4c20efd64be815b5c058b54fa82b9fd OP_EQUAL
address
3LrpgTkGBZQaLXQQXduBDEXSPQ9NcpmgPL
transaction
e5ca9046bfec602d9b866b7784a8f1fbaf5e600a5429932bc7bb45e94c494da7
spent
true